Overview
The Care Coordinator provides clerical and administrative support to the Palliative Care program. This position answers, screens and directs phone calls, including coordinating the process of new referrals, schedules patient appointments and works closely with patients, family members/caregivers and Palliative Care staff to ensure efficient coordination of services.
Key Responsibilities
- Answer, screen, and direct phone calls related to palliative care services.
- Respond to inquiries from patients, families, and providers; explain program services and eligibility.
- Coordinate the process of new referrals to the palliative care program.
- Schedule patient appointments and manage calendar logistics.
- Collaborate with providers, nurses, social workers, and other staff to ensure smooth care coordination.
- Enter and maintain accurate patient and insurance information in electronic health records.
- Communicate documentation needs for billing and insurance compliance.
- Provide administrative support, prepare reports, and assist with outreach activities.
